LOG: [clang-doc] Improving Markdown Output

This change has two components. The moves the generated file
for a namespace to the directory named after the namespace in
a file named 'index.<format>'. This greatly improves the browsing
experience since the index page is shown by default for a directory.

The second improves the markdown output by adding the links to the
referenced pages for children objects and the link back to the source
code.
